The City Council created the Commission for Participation and Transparency (19/10/2015)

"We seek an active and ongoing participation that emphasizes on the real problems of the citizens and their priority needs," he said Councilman Jose Guillen.

All political groups of the Municipal Corporation are invited to join this Commission.

One of the priorities is the modification of the current Rules of Engagement, to facilitate the involvement of residents in the decisions of the City

The City of Murcia, through the Department of Administration Modernization, Urban Quality and Participation, has summoned the representatives of the different political groups that make up the municipal corporation, to the Commission for participation and transparency.

Is expected to be next Friday when it meets for the first time this Commission plural work, which aims to open new channels of citizen participation, a goal that the City has become one of its priority areas of action, as evidenced by the direct participation of neighbors, associations, social workers and neighborhood groups in the new 2020 Strategy Murcia City.

"We seek an active and ongoing participation that emphasizes on the real problems of the citizens and their priority needs," he stressed the Councillor for Participation, Jose Guillen, adding that "currently, Murcia those who wish to express their views on the development strategy of the municipality, on the public platform, available in www.murcia.es. "

"We want to hear all voices and build, every day, the future of Murcia together.

Our project does not exclude anyone and commitment to social and economic growth with real action, "said the mayor, who said that" before the end of the year ready Murcia City Strategy 2020 ".

This roadmap will allow adapt policies and public services to the preferences of Murcia and its social context, giving priority to co-governance and social responsibility instead.

Moreover, Jose Guillen said that "participation helps to strengthen core values ​​of local democracy, such as transparency and control of citizens on the measures and actions taken by the political representatives".

Among the different issues to be addressed by the Commission to be held on Friday, it highlights the modification of the current Regulation of Citizen Participation, and the specific regulation time or permanent use to local civic organizations.
